Sophie has competed in a wide variety of athletics including cross country, rugby, track, Crossfit, and powerlifting. She’s competed in national level powerlifting meets, and currently holds a few USAPL Oregon State records. Working as a personal trainer and powerlifting coach, Sophie realized her love for helping others find their strength and rehab from injuries. This led her to enroll in the D.C. program. She earned her Doctorate in Chiropractic and her Masters in Sports Medicine from Western States University here in Portland, OR. Sophie grew up watching her mom lift weights and run marathons. On sick days, her mom would take her to work at an MRI center and show her the scans of different anatomical structures (oh the 90’s). These early experiences ignited her love for fitness and the human body, which she hopes to pass onto her patients. In her free time, Sophie likes eating good food with her wife and their dog, Spike.
**Please note cash rates require an additional $49 sign-up (annual) with ChiroHealth USA.** Your initial visit with Move Better is longer than most clinic intakes. It will be 2 hours. Your exam can include physical therapy exercises, bodywork, and chiropractic manipulation. Not all of these services are required or needed. Treatment will focusing on answering the most important question: "Why do I have pain?" There is a significant amount of education as to why we are doing what we are doing.
